What is Foreign Buyer Profile

The Company Profile for Foreign Buyers is a vendor registration form used by companies to provide detailed information for participation in exhibitions organized by Ente Autonomo Fiere di Verona.

What is the Company Profile for Foreign Buyers?

The Company Profile for Foreign Buyers is essential for foreign businesses looking to participate in exhibitions organized by Ente Autonomo Fiere di Verona. This form collects necessary data from buyers, making it integral to the registration process. It serves to streamline communication and ensure that exhibitors accurately represent their capabilities and offerings.
Completing the foreign buyer registration form not only enhances participation efficiency but also helps establish credibility in a competitive market.
